It is with the heaviest of hearts we're sad to announce the passing of our beloved husband, father, grandfather, brother, uncle, and friend, Big Ed.
Edward "Big Ed" Winhoven, a resident of Julian, WV, went home to Jesus on August 30, 2022, at the age of 65, after a short, hard, and intense battle with cholangiocarcinoma.
Big Ed was born to Floyd Louis Winhoven and Jeanette Henson Winhoven on November 10, 1956, at Dayton, OH.
Ed was a man of many talents. He was a truck driver for Harless Paving for approximately 20 years. In his free time, he loved picking up odd jobs including excavating and snow plowing, among many other things.
Big Ed is preceded in death by his parents, Floyd and Jeanette Winhoven; three brothers, Steven L. Winhoven, Harold R. Bishop, and Freddy M. Bishop; his parents-in-law, Raymond and Faye Morgan; and one brother-in-law, Steven L. Morgan.
He is survived by his soulmate and wife of 40 years, Melanie Morgan Winhoven. Together, they had two children, Ashley (Josh) Davis of Morristown, TN, and Edward (Amy) Winhoven of Julian, WV. He is also survived by Nicholas Suthard, who he thought of as a son, of Julian, WV; his sidekick, Frankie Payne; five grandchildren, Emma Turner, Jaelynn Davis, Jason Turner, Ryker Davis, and Kambri Davis; and his sister (who, by the way, brought sexy back), Sharon (Devandra) Trivedi of Scottsdale, AZ. Additionally, Big Ed leaves behind a host of nieces and nephews along with countless wonderful friends, too many to name.
In honor of Big Ed's wishes, his remains will be cremated, and a celebration of life will be held at a later date.
Arrangements have been entrusted to the care of Evans Funeral Home & Cremation Services of Chapmanville, WV.
